TY - JOUR ID - 6537 AU - Mertl, Jan PY - 2017 TI - Private prepaid health financing schemes' role in health system PB - VŠE CY - Praha SN - 9788024522388 KW - prepaid programs KW - health insurance KW - health system N2 - One of main obstacles with private financing of health care is the dependency of common insurance product on medical underwriting and pre-existing conditions. In countries like Czechia, where universal health care system exists, this ensures necessary solidarity between healthy and sick citizens and financing objectively needed health care. Suggesting private coinsurance to supplement this system may work for some scenarios but many clients and life situations will be excluded from real possibilities to use it. Therefore, we discuss possible role for prepaid schemes that are independent of health status at the time of buying and provide flexible options for clients that want to allocate their private resources for care above the universally needed and available standard. Although they are not able to cover up for classic insurance scenarios – covering random insurance events usually with high costs, they are able to provide treatment programs that will supplement standard therapeutic and preventive care.
